At the core of advanced casino logic is the use of intelligent algorithms to manage game outcomes and reward structures. Modern online casinos employ Random Number Generators (RNGs) to ensure fairness in slot machines, table games, and other casino offerings. While fairness is maintained, operators can strategically design payout percentages, volatility levels, and bonus triggers to optimize profitability. High-volatility games, for example, may offer larger jackpots but fewer wins, encouraging higher stakes and prolonged engagement. Low-volatility games provide frequent smaller wins, promoting player retention and steady activity. By balancing these factors, advanced logic allows casinos to maintain an equilibrium between profitability and player satisfaction.
Data analytics is a cornerstone of optimizing profit potential. Casinos collect and analyze extensive player data, including betting patterns, session duration, preferred games, and responsiveness to promotions. Advanced logic systems use this data to forecast trends, identify high-value players, and tailor reward programs that maximize engagement. Predictive models can anticipate player behavior, such as which users are likely to increase stakes or participate in promotions, allowing operators to strategically target incentives. This level of analysis ensures that resources are allocated efficiently, enhancing profitability while maintaining a positive player experience.
Reward structures are also optimized using advanced casino logic. Bonuses, loyalty programs, cashback offers, and free spins are carefully calibrated to encourage player activity without eroding profit margins. For instance, tiered loyalty systems provide incremental incentives, motivating players to maintain consistent gameplay. High-frequency small rewards keep players engaged, while progressive jackpots and exclusive promotions drive high-stakes participation. By strategically structuring rewards, casinos can maximize both player satisfaction and revenue, creating a sustainable model for long-term profitability.
